Understanding Extended Auto Warranties and Their Benefits

An extended auto warranty kicks in after your initial standard warranty expires. It is similar to an insurance policy that covers the cost of certain repairs and problems that arise with your vehicle, extending the period of financial protection. This extended coverage helps to maintain your car’s longevity and ensure a smoother ownership experience.

The benefits of extended warranties are not just limited to covering repair costs. They often include additional services such as roadside assistance, rental car reimbursement, and trip interruption service. These perks add value by ensuring that, even when your car is incapacitated, your mobility and plans are kept intact.

Investing in an extended auto warranty can also increase the resale value of your vehicle. 

A transferable warranty implies maintained upkeep and reliability, making it more attractive to potential buyers. It’s an invisible badge of honor that suggests confidence in the vehicle’s performance and longevity.

Mitigating Unexpected Repair Costs with Extended Protection

Unexpected repair costs can emerge without warning, and they often do so at inconvenient times. With labor rates and parts prices increasing, a single mechanical issue can result in a steep financial setback. Extended auto warranties serve as a buffer between you and these unexpected expenses.

Consider the case of major systems failing, like the vehicle engine or transmission. Without a warranty, the out-of-pocket expense can run into thousands of dollars. An extended warranty can absorb the brunt of these costs, keeping your savings intact. It’s a strategic safeguard against the unpredictability of mechanical breakdowns.

Besides covering big-ticket repairs, extended warranties can also handle an accumulation of small repairs that add up over time. Electrical issues, air conditioning malfunctions, or suspension problems often occur incrementally. Without coverage, the total cost of repeated fixes can balloon past the cost of an extended warranty.

Moreover, warranties that include diagnostics can prevent minor issues from escalating into major problems. By allowing for regular check-ups and maintenance, you can address potential issues early, preserving the integrity of your vehicle while avoiding larger bills down the road.

Common Vehicle Repairs That Are Expensive

In order to discover how extended auto warranties are useful, one must first know what kind of repairs a vehicle deals with. Generally, these are quite expensive and might take a toll on your budget. So, if you want to save some serious money, here are a few vehicle repairs that can help you:

Replacement Of The Engine Control Module

Vehicles that are new consist of an engine control module. This particular equipment is capable of controlling all car processes along with the engine’s timing. Once gone bad, this module can end up causing tremendous problems inside your vehicle and some of them are completely inoperable. Thus, an extended warranty can save up to $963 to $1040 of your budget. 

Head Gasket Changes

One of the biggest nightmares of a vehicle is a failed head gasket. These are responsible for preventing fluids from getting inside the engine block. Ultimately, it blocks leaking and keeps the seal of the engine as it is. Getting up to the head gasket is not at all easy. Hence, the labor might charge you from $1,853 to $2,149, which is easily saved with extended warranties. 

Timing Belt Replacement

The timing belt of your vehicle is in charge of the camshafts turning and making the piston revolve. Most of these belts go on for several years, but they will either snap or stretch. Ultimately, it makes your vehicle useless. But not when you have an extended auto warranty in place. By replacing the right equipment, it saves up to $770 to $800. 

Replacing The Fuel Injector

Your car’s fuel injectors are responsible for firing gasoline right inside the combustion chamber of your engine. If fuel injectors get dirty or clogged for any reason, the repair might cost you immensely. Hence, it is ideal to replace the fuel injection system, which otherwise costs anywhere between $650 to $750. 

The Long-Term Savings Of Investing In Extended Auto Warranties

The most significant impact of an extended auto warranty is the potential long-term savings for car owners. With the average lifespan of a vehicle on the rise, the likelihood of incurring repair costs grows with each mile. An extended warranty can pay for itself with just one or two significant repairs.

As technology in vehicles advances, repairs become more complex and expensive. Extended warranties are evolving to accommodate the costly nature of fixing sophisticated electrical systems and hybrid engine components. By investing in a warranty plan, you’re likewise investing in future-proofing your finances against high-tech repairs.
